Yes, your refrigerator is an electrical appliance. Your plumber won't fix your fridge or fridge freezer, yet if it has an ice manufacturer attached, you ought to call your plumber to repair that component.
Your ice manufacturer has its water line, and also this link can get leaky or clogged up. When you alter your refrigerator, you should reconnect your ice maker, otherwise it might establish a mistake.
If it is redeemable, your plumber can analyze your ice manufacturer as well as inform you. You can alter your icemaker without altering your refrigerator if it's not.

Let's say your refrigerator or washing machine isn't working. But "not working" is such a generic term that a Google search doesn't help you get any closer to solving the problem.



Repair Clinic is an excellent place for the layperson to figure out what the actual issue is, and how to fix it.



Start at "Repair Help" and key in the malfunctioning appliance's model number or choose from a list of products. You will see a list of several common problems with that type of product, in plain English, so you can figure out what is and isn't your problem. This is where Repair Clinic is better than a random Google search.



Once you've found your problem, go through the recommended solutions one by one. Repair Clinic lists them by severity, so make sure you have ruled out the first cause before moving on the next one.



The website claims it has over 4,500 videos by technicians, over 7,000 diagrams and manuals, and over 700 articles to solve common problems.



Apart from suggesting fixes, Repair Clinic also sells parts and shows you how to remove, replace, or install items. If they still ship to you, you might save money with a DIY repair job.
